Vigil Held In Anaheim For Slain Homeless Veteran

ANAHEIM (CBS) — A vigil was held Saturday night for homeless Vietnam veteran John Barry at the murder scene where his body was found.

Barry was the fourth homeless man killed in Orange County since December 20. Known to friends as John, he was a well known and well liked fixture in Anaheim.

"We are extremely confident that we have the man who is responsible for the murders of all four homeless men in Orange County," said Chief John Welter of the Anaheim Police Department.

Police credit two witnesses for chasing down the suspected killer identified by authorities as Itzcoatl Ocampo.

Police have requested that Ocampo, who is behind bars, be charged with all four murders. The 23-year-old is a marine who was having trouble finding a job.

He lived with his mother in a rental property in Yorba Linda where police executed a search warrant this weekend.
